.doc-feedback{background:var(--wp--preset--color--neutral-50,#f9fafb);border:1px solid var(--wp--custom--border--color,#e5e7eb);border-radius:var(--wp--custom--border--radius,6px);padding:2rem;transition:all .2s ease}.doc-feedback__title{font-size:1rem;font-weight:600;margin:0 0 .5rem}.doc-feedback__message{font-size:.875rem;line-height:1.5;margin:0 0 1.5rem}.doc-feedback__options{display:flex;flex-wrap:wrap;gap:.5rem;justify-content:center}.doc-feedback__option{align-items:center;background:#fff;border:none;border-radius:var(--wp--custom--border--radius,6px);cursor:pointer;display:flex;font-family:inherit;justify-content:center;min-height:60px;min-width:60px;padding:.5rem;position:relative;transition:all .2s ease}.doc-feedback__option:hover{background:#f1f5f9;border-color:#0542fa}.doc-feedback__option:hover:after{animation:doc-feedback-tooltip-show .2s ease forwards;background:#1e293b;border-radius:6px;bottom:100%;color:#fff;content:attr(title);font-size:.75rem;font-weight:500;left:50%;margin-bottom:.5rem;opacity:0;padding:.5rem .75rem;position:absolute;transform:translateX(-50%);white-space:nowrap;z-index:10}.doc-feedback__option.is--selected{background:#ecfdf5;border-color:#10b981}.doc-feedback__emoji{font-size:1.5rem;line-height:1}.doc-feedback__status{align-items:center;border-radius:8px;display:flex;font-size:.875rem;font-weight:500;gap:.5rem;justify-content:center}.doc-feedback__status.is--submitted{color:#047857}.doc-feedback__status.is--loading{opacity:.7}.doc-feedback__status-icon{font-size:1rem}.doc-feedback__status-text{font-size:.875rem}.doc-feedback__loading{align-items:center;color:#64748b;display:flex;font-size:.875rem;gap:.5rem;justify-content:center}.doc-feedback__loading-spinner{animation:doc-feedback-spin 1s linear infinite;border:2px solid var(--wp--custom--border--color,#e5e7eb);border-radius:50%;border-top:2px solid #0542fa;height:16px;width:16px}.doc-feedback__loading-text{font-size:.875rem}.doc-feedback__error{align-items:center;border-radius:8px;color:#dc2626;display:flex;font-size:.875rem;gap:.5rem;justify-content:center}.doc-feedback__error-icon{font-size:1rem}.doc-feedback__error-text{font-size:.875rem}.doc-feedback.has-text-align-left{text-align:left}.doc-feedback.has-text-align-left .doc-feedback__error,.doc-feedback.has-text-align-left .doc-feedback__loading,.doc-feedback.has-text-align-left .doc-feedback__options,.doc-feedback.has-text-align-left .doc-feedback__status{justify-content:flex-start}.doc-feedback.has-text-align-right{text-align:right}.doc-feedback.has-text-align-right .doc-feedback__error,.doc-feedback.has-text-align-right .doc-feedback__loading,.doc-feedback.has-text-align-right .doc-feedback__options,.doc-feedback.has-text-align-right .doc-feedback__status{justify-content:flex-end}.doc-feedback.has-text-align-center{text-align:center}.doc-feedback.has-text-align-center .doc-feedback__error,.doc-feedback.has-text-align-center .doc-feedback__loading,.doc-feedback.has-text-align-center .doc-feedback__options,.doc-feedback.has-text-align-center .doc-feedback__status{justify-content:center}.doc-feedback--centered{text-align:center}@media(max-width:480px){.doc-feedback{padding:1rem}.doc-feedback .doc-feedback__options{gap:.5rem}.doc-feedback .doc-feedback__option{min-height:50px;min-width:50px;padding:.5rem}.doc-feedback .doc-feedback__emoji{font-size:1.25rem}}@keyframes doc-feedback-spin{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es doc-feedback-tooltip-show{0%{opacity:0;transform:translateX(-50%) translateY(4px)}to{opacity:1;transform:translateX(-50%) translateY(0)}}
